The best and only answer is that it depends on how well the person heals and recovers from the inflammatory episodes related to their injuries.

Acute inflammation should be a temporary event following an injury, acute inflammatory mediators and the immune system should clean up the damaged tissues and signal the healing process to begin. This would allow for the best prognosis as the person will heal and recover and be done with it.

In other words, the acute inflammatory process would do its thing and then shut off.

But what if this doesn’t happen, or what if a person was already chronically inflamed before the injury?

Now this could spell trouble and a lot of it, and for quite a long time!

Regardless of a person’s ambition, whether it’s to get out of pain, keep chronic injuries from flaring up, or simply want to prevent falling apart too soon, there is a single plan of action and that is to resolve chronic inflammation.

Chronic inflammation is slow long-term inflammation that can last for several months to years.

Think of a slow smoldering fire that never resolves and you have a pretty good idea of the destructive power of chronic inflammation.

And keep in mind, chronic inflammation is not limited to the joints and tissues that were originally injured- chronic inflammation can be systemic and adversely impact the entire body.

Here’s a thought: chronic knee pain and inflammatory conditions like arthritis can increase the risk of cardiovascular disease and other heart conditions.

Those with osteoarthritis of the knees are almost 3 times more likely to develop cardiovascular disease or heart disease than those without osteoarthritis.

And don’t breathe a sigh of relief because your knees are good…, this would apply to any chronic joint pain.

A person can take over-the-counter anti-inflammatories to reduce pain, but the inflammatory process continues to smolder, and who knows what it is targeting in your body?
